<br />Earlier editions of this incomparable guide came in separate volumes for
the United States, Europe, and Scandinavia, as these three areas represent
significant segments of CISG practice and also notable variations in the
application of the Convention. Today, however, the CISG has gained greater
prominence in dozens of jurisdictions worldwide, and similarities as well as
differences in how the Convention is understood and applied have become
increasingly relevant for all CISG practitioners. Hence, a ‘worldwide’
edition, focused on the rules and case law of greatest practical importance in
all Contracting States, is here provided—although this new edition continues
to account for regional anomalies insofar as they impact on the interests of
merchants (and their lawyers) in the real CISG world.

With this book as their guide, lawyers handling international sales contracts
and disputes in any jurisdiction will confidently navigate such areas of
practice as the following:

</p>
<p>
• determining when the CISG applies;
</p>
<p>
• freedom of contract under Article 6;
</p>
<p>
• interpretation and good faith;
</p>
<p>
• formation, validity, defenses to enforcement;
</p>
<p>
• notice of non-conformity;
</p>
<p>
• damages for breach, mitigation;
</p>
<p>
• Article 79 liability exemptions;
</p>
<p>
• agreed remedies, disclaimers; and
</p>
<p>
• key reservations under Articles 92-96.
</p>
<p>
Understanding the CISG includes a representative sampling of the more than
2,000 CISG court judgements and arbitral awards that have been reported.
Concrete illustrations are provided to help clarify the (sometimes complex)
way CISG rules work. Five appendices offer a wealth of reference material,
including the complete text of the Convention and an extensive table of cases
and arbitral awards.

Prof. Lookofsky, Joseph
Joseph Lookofsky is Professor of Law at the University of Copenhagen. In addition to his Danish law degrees, he holds a J.D. degree from the New York University School of Law. He is a Member of the New York State Bar and former in-house counsel for United Artists Corporation.
